The Role
The People Excellence and Change Lead drives initiatives that enhance employee and manager experience, providing a key point of view on the strategy and how to implement it in Hiscox. It ensures initiatives are designed around employee and manager needs, business outcomes, operational effectiveness, and sustainable adoption.
The People function enables Hiscox to attract, develop, and retain the talent needed to achieve its strategic goals. This role sits within the People Experience family and contributes at career level 3b: Principal / Lead Professional / Senior Manager. It works closely with people leadership, business leaders, employees, talent acquisition, centres of excellence, enterprise technology, COO function, and programme stakeholders.
The role owns significant functional outcomes, resolves complex issues, influences broader business decisions, and provides lead specialist / manager accountability with broad autonomy. It applies specialist knowledge and existing methodologies to complex problems, guides others in resolving complex issues, and makes strategic and cross-functional recommendations.
Role Focus & Decision Making
- Shape and deliver the employee and manager experience, ensuring people feel valued, supported, and connected throughout their lifecycle at Hiscox.
- Provide the key People Experience point of view on the strategy for implementing People priorities across Hiscox, balancing employee, manager, and business needs.
- Lead and evolve the employee value proposition (EVP) for Hiscox, ensuring it reflects the colleague experience, culture, and talent priorities.
- Provide programme and change management support for key People programmes, including centre of excellence initiatives and M&A-related activity.
- Lead on the People technology roadmap in partnership with the People function and enterprise technology, ensuring technology choices improve experience, efficiency, and adoption.
- Drive operational excellence and identify where AI can improve People service delivery, manager enablement, colleague experience, and process quality.
- Own or support implementation of priority People programmes such as chat agents, global time tracking, and Microsoft lab collaboration.
- Support People outcomes that improve capability, engagement, organisational effectiveness, and consistency across Hiscox.
- Apply policy, process, judgement, and governance consistently while balancing employee and business needs.
- Use insight and feedback to improve People processes, service quality, and decision-making.
- Resolve queries and coordinate activity in line with policy, service standards, and business expectations.

Diversity and Hybrid working
At Hiscox we care about our people. We hire the best people for the job and we’re committed to diversity and creating a truly inclusive culture, which we believe drives success.
We have also learned over the past few years that working life doesn’t always have to be in the office, and now it is safe to do so we have introduced hybrid working to encourage a healthy work life balance.
This hybrid working model is set by the team rather than the business to enable you to manage your own personal work-life balance. We see it as the best of both worlds; structure and sociability on one hand, and independence and flexibility on the other.
